Company Description
Mytos Bio Limited is a $19M YC-backed biotech automation company based in London’s Imperial College Innovation Hub. They develop advanced machines to fully automate human cell production, replacing manual processes for multibillion-dollar biotech firms to accelerate cures for diseases like Parkinson’s and cancer through high‑precision engineering.
